GL Studio C++ Runtime API
Toggle main menu visibility
Main Page
Related Pages
Namespaces
Namespace List
Namespace Members
All
a
b
c
d
e
f
g
h
i
l
m
n
o
p
q
r
s
t
u
v
x
y
z
Functions
a
b
c
d
e
f
g
i
l
m
n
o
p
q
r
s
t
u
v
Variables
Typedefs
c
d
f
g
i
l
r
u
v
Enumerations
a
c
d
e
f
g
i
l
m
p
r
s
t
v
Enumerator
a
d
e
g
m
n
p
r
s
t
x
y
z
Classes
Class List
Class Index
Class Hierarchy
Class Members
All
_
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
~
Functions
a
b
c
d
e
f
g
h
i
j
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
~
Variables
_
a
b
c
d
e
f
g
h
i
k
l
m
n
o
p
q
r
s
t
u
v
w
x
y
z
Typedefs
_
a
b
c
d
e
f
g
i
k
l
m
o
p
r
s
t
v
Enumerations
Enumerator
Related Functions
Files
File List
File Members
All
_
b
c
d
f
g
i
l
m
n
o
p
r
s
t
u
Functions
Variables
Typedefs
Enumerations
Macros
_
c
d
f
g
i
l
m
n
o
p
s
t
•
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Friends
Macros
Pages
DistiAttribute< T > Member List
This is the complete list of members for
DistiAttribute< T >
, including all inherited members.
_attribPtr
DistiAttribute< T >
protected
_callback
DistiAttributeBase
protected
_localStorage
DistiAttributeBase
protected
_name
DistiAttributeBase
protected
_observerList
DistiAttributeBase
protected
_precision
DistiAttribute< T >
protected
_weakRefs
WeakReferenceableMixin
protected
AddWeakReference
(WeakReference *weakRef) override
WeakReferenceableMixin
inline
virtual
CallbackID
typedef
DistiAttributeBase
CallCallback
()
DistiAttributeBase
virtual
Copyable
() const override
DistiAttribute< T >
inline
virtual
DistiAttribute
(CallbackMethodCallerBase *callback, const AttributeName &name, T *attribPtr)
DistiAttribute< T >
inline
DistiAttribute
(CallbackMethodCallerBase *callback, const AttributeName &name, const T &initialValue)
DistiAttribute< T >
inline
DistiAttributeBase
(CallbackMethodCallerBase *callback, const AttributeName &name, bool localStorage)
DistiAttributeBase
LocalStorage
() const
DistiAttributeBase
Name
() const
DistiAttributeBase
Name
()
DistiAttributeBase
NotifyObservers
()
DistiAttributeBase
virtual
NotifyWeakReferenceDestroyed
(WeakReference *ref) override
WeakReferenceableMixin
inline
virtual
OkToWrite
() const
DistiAttributeBase
virtual
operator<<
(const valType &val)
DistiAttributeBase
inline
operator=
(const DistiAttributeBase &oldClass) override
DistiAttribute< T >
inline
virtual
operator==
(const DistiAttributeBase &rArg) override
DistiAttribute< T >
inline
virtual
operator>>
(valType &val)
DistiAttributeBase
inline
ReadValue
(std::istream &instr) override
DistiAttribute< T >
inline
virtual
RegisterObserver
(AttributeObserver *observer)
DistiAttributeBase
virtual
ResetValueChanged
()
DistiAttributeBase
virtual
UnregisterObserver
(CallbackID id)
DistiAttributeBase
virtual
Value
()
DistiAttribute< T >
inline
virtual
Value
(const T &val)
DistiAttribute< T >
inline
virtual
ValueChanged
()
DistiAttributeBase
virtual
ValueFloat
() override
DistiAttribute< T >
inline
virtual
ValueFloat
(double val) override
DistiAttribute< T >
inline
virtual
ValueInt
() override
DistiAttribute< T >
inline
virtual
ValueInt
(long val) override
DistiAttribute< T >
inline
virtual
ValueString
()
DistiAttributeBase
virtual
ValueString
(const std::string &s)
DistiAttributeBase
virtual
WeakReferenceableMixin
()
WeakReferenceableMixin
inline
protected
WriteValue
(std::ostream &outstr) override
DistiAttribute< T >
inline
virtual
~DistiAttribute
() override
DistiAttribute< T >
inline
~DistiAttributeBase
() (defined in
DistiAttributeBase
)
DistiAttributeBase
virtual
~WeakReferenceable
() (defined in
WeakReferenceable
)
WeakReferenceable
inline
virtual
~WeakReferenceableMixin
()
WeakReferenceableMixin
inline
protected
virtual
Generated by
1.9.4